Survival rate is a part of survival analysis. It is the percentage of people in a study or treatment group still alive for a given period of time after diagnosis. It is a method of describing prognosis in certain disease conditions. Survival rate can be used as yardstick for the assessment of standards of therapy. The survival period is usually reckoned from date of diagnosis or start of treatment. Survival rates are important for prognosis, but because the rate is based on the population as a whole, an individual prognosis may be different depending on newer treatments since the last statistical analysis as well as the overall general health of the patient. There are various types of survival rates (discussed below). They often serve as endpoints of clinical trials and should not be confused with mortality rates, a population metric.

The invention relates to a stichopus japonicus powder feed and a processing method thereof and belongs to the technical field of feeds and processing methods thereof. The stichopus japonicus powder feed is characterized by comprising the following ingredients by weight percent: 30-50% of degummed kelp dry powder, 10-20% of sargassum thunbergii dry powder, 15-25% of gulfweed dry powder, 8-13% of perforated sea lettuce dry powder, 5-12% of fish powder, 4-8% of yeast powder and 1-3% of complex vitamin. The processing flow comprises the following steps: collecting raw materials, degumming kelp, drying the raw materials, mixing the raw materials, performing coarse crushing, mixing with the fish powder and stirring, performing superfine crushing and packaging. Nutritional ingredients in the stichopus japonicus powder feed are good in stability, the growth speed and cultivation survival rate of stichopus japonicus can be effectively improved, the growth speed obtained by adopting the stichopus japonicus powder feed is faster than that obtained by adopting other types of the feed by 1.5-2.0 times, the survival rate is high, the weight-increasing rate is fast, and the production efficiencyof cultivation of the stichopus japonicus is greatly improved. Simultaneously, the pollution on a cultivation water body is reduced, and the growth speed of the stichopus japonicus is improved.

The invention discloses a cuttage method of rose. The method includes the steps of first, selecting and making cuttings; second, preparing nutrient solution; third, making cutting blocks; fourth, performing cuttage, namely inserting made rose stems into flower mud, pouring the cuttage nutrient solution into a plastic tray, placing the rose stems, inserted into the flower mud, in the plastic tray, ensuring one third of each cutting block is immerged in the nutrient solution, placing the plastic tray in the environment with 2000-3000lux illumination and good ventilation, and moving the plastic tray with the flower mud into a flowerpot after all cuttings root. The method has the advantages that required materials are convenient to obtain, and no high technical demands are require; unlike all-light spraying requiring many automatic devices, the method requires regular addition of the nutrient solution only; rooting is fast; antibiotics are continuously used in the cuttage process, invasion of pathogens into cuttings can be controlled effectively, cutting quality is improved, and fewer cuttings degrade; transplanting survival rate is high.

The invention discloses a ligusticum wallichii cultivation method capable of reducing plant pest and disease damage and increasing survival rate and yield. The method comprises the following steps: sequentially performing rice seedling planting and rice harvesting, regular soil preparation, poria seed planting, field management and ligusticum wallichii harvesting within a planting period; specifically, in the regular soil preparation, performing immersed soaking treatment on farmland with rice harvested, soaking and draining accumulated water out of the field, ploughing, then finely raking, flattening surface soil, ditching and excavating shallow trenches; in the poria seed planting step, performing cuttage on poria seeds at the bottom of the shallow trenches, and immediately covering with straws along the shallow trenches after cuttage; and in the field management step, supplementing seedlings, weeding, draining water, applying fertilizer and performing pest and disease prevention. According to the ligusticum wallichii cultivation method, the block stem rotten sickness and grub damage of the ligusticum wallichii can be effectively reduced, the physiological seedling death and withering are effectively prevented, the purpose of returning straws to the field can be achieved, the root development of the ligusticum wallichii can be promoted, the field weeds can be reduced, and the yield of the ligusticum wallichi can be effectively increased.

The invention relates to a treatment method of Acer mandshuricum Maxim. for seedling emergence in a dormancy-breaking year. The invention aims to solve the problems in the prior art that after Acer mandshuricum Maxim. seeds are sown, the seeds need to stay in nurseries for winter, thus the seedling raising time is long, the seedling emergence rate is low, and the management and protection costs are high. The treatment method comprises the following steps: (1) selecting seeds, and soaking the seeds repeatedly; (2) conducting disinfection and conducting cleaning; (3) mixing the cleaned seeds and wet river sand in proportion, and placing the mixture for 7-10 days at a temperature of 10-15 DEG C; (4) conducting stratification treatment; (5) conducting freezing, conducting unfreezing after freezing, and storing the unfrozen seeds in a cellar; and (6) placing the seeds and the river sand which are stored in the cellar to outdoor shady places for vernalization, and sieving the river sand out of the seeds for seed sowing. The treatment method provided in the invention breaks the comprehensive dormancy of the Acer mandshuricum Maxim. seeds, seedlings can normally emerge in the current year after sowing, and the seedling emergence is ordered, the seedling emergence rate can reach 82% or more, seedling raising time is shortened, the seedling survival rate is improved, the management and protection costs are reduced, and the method is suitable for breaking dormancy of the Acer mandshuricum Maxim. seeds.
